A new frontier for space‑based data processing
SpaceX has officially announced the name Starmind for its upcoming AI‑focused satellite constellation. The designation refers to a network of satellites that will provide artificial‑intelligence computing power directly from orbit.
Ambitious target: one million nodes
CEO Elon Musk stated that the project aims to deploy up to one million orbital compute nodes. Each node will be capable of running AI algorithms independently, processing data in space without relying on ground‑based data centers.
Potential impact on terrestrial data centers
Shifting compute capacity to orbit could dramatically reduce latency for certain applications. Proponents see the possibility of complementing—or eventually replacing—traditional Earth‑bound data centers, especially for time‑critical services such as global image analysis, real‑time translation, or autonomous navigation.
Technical challenges
Establishing a constellation of this scale presents significant engineering hurdles, including satellite power supply, cooling high‑performance chips in vacuum, and secure over‑the‑air software updates. SpaceX plans to leverage its proven manufacturing processes from rocket production to lower per‑satellite costs.
Timeline and next steps
No detailed schedule has been released yet, but initial test satellites are expected to launch within the next few years. Ongoing development will depend on regulatory approvals and international agreements governing the use of near‑Earth space.
